Greatest Southern Nights featuring Ocean Alley review – Australia’s live music comeback is a tepid affair – The Guardian
The biggest indoor music event since March is a reason to celebrate even if the chilled-out headliners fall emotionally flat

Even before arriving on a filthily hot day to Sydneys Olympic Park, the adjectives about Saturday nights big gig have been beefed up into superlatives.
Great Southern Nights is the name of the state governments support of 1,000 Covid-safe gigs across New South Wales in November, but tonight is the first in the programs finale of two concerts called Greatest Southern Nights.
